Rational Minorities... not easy solutions for a brazilian mix population!

After some theory of justice studies, someone try to solve a social problem with a race/racist solution...

The example is real, based in the minority special quotes at the universities:
  • 160 students selected per year for public the medical universities of Curitiba (my city, my university)
  • Minorities were not represented at there.
  • Since 2006, a new inclusion rules save 20% for black, 20% for public school students, 5% for native brazilian indians and 5% for disabilities.
  • My position in 1996: 123º
The orientals were strongly segregate!
Copy and paste, a North American/European solution, will never work in our complex society.

Elite Squad 2 - the movie and social influences.

Elite Squad 1 was a huge sucess  in 2008. A brazilian Golden Bear in Berlin! A lot of brazilian fans! Lines from the movie got in daily life. I loved this film. Loved... in past. Now, we have Elite Squad 2, today at the theater!


http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=gsZP9ZX3fsI

After my own most personal violent experience, a kidnapping at 31st of December of 2009. I change myself and my view about violence and about Elite Squad.I'll watch this movie for sure... My concern is the simplicist view that violence can be understood, as it happened with Elite Squad1. Violence was treated with more violence and there is a happy end...!

In real life,  an old policial officer chief with a cerebral hematoma told me in his hospital bed, the secrets to reduce violence in Brazil would be: Education, Health and Safety... just safety by killing "the bad guys", it is a videogame illusion. More bad guys will appear if you don´t fix the other parts of the chain... and they will take your girlfriend or they will shout you in your face.

Violence is an important subject seen for most of people just in the which way is the best for protect themselves... if this way of protection is not well worked, the fear will grow and we will be prisioners.
